Hi
Is this possible. I have wired in smoke detectors in each room in a 4 bed semi. However they are not loud enough and I worry in the event of a fire they will not wake anyone if they sound during the night. I'd like to retrofit a fire alarm to the system which sounds if any smoke detector goes off in the home. Please advise if this is possible. I can provide the makes of the smoke detectors if required.
What would be the cheapest and most elegant solution.

Thanks in advance for any replies.

As long as they are linked using 3 core & earth cable, they should be able to be replaced with other mains powered smokes. I would suggest Aico, meaning no disrespect but if you can sleep through those going off your deaf.
You would be best off getting advice from a good local electrician who can see what's installed and give you better advice.
 
Think the OP has provided live feed to each new detector and not linked them?

OP you could install 'radio linked' detectors, which while not cheap, would negate the need to hard wire between each detector. I would also consider installing a control switch as well.

I would also concur with the advice of employing a competent electrician.
 
Out of interest why the need to provide smoke detectors in each room? I think an interlinked high quality smoke detection system(aico) should suffice in your situation. Best get an electrician in to offer some advice.
